The recent ban on TT by the US Government has stirred significant debate among users and advocates. This controversial decision stems from concerns about data privacy and national security, leading to a broader discussion on the balance between regulation and innovation. Users of TT express fears regarding the loss of a platform that fosters creativity and social connection. As similar bans are considered globally, the implications extend beyond just one app. Many are advocating for clearer regulations that protect users while ensuring that innovation is not stifled. The outcome of this situation may set a precedent for how digital platforms operate in the future, underlining the need for a conversation about responsible tech use and governance. With rising scrutiny on personal data management, the decision highlights the ongoing challenge of safeguarding user rights while addressing legitimate security concerns. This is a crucial moment that could redefine the relationship between government regulations and social media platforms.
